The Oberliga Schleswig-Holstein, formerly referred to as Schleswig-Holstein-Liga, is the fifth tier of the German football league system and the highest league in the German state of Schleswig-Holstein. It is one of fourteen Oberligas in German football.

The Germany Oberliga Schleswig-Holstein is a prominent regional soccer tournament that showcases the competitive spirit and talent of clubs from the Schleswig-Holstein region. As part of the Oberliga tier, it serves as a crucial stepping stone for teams aspiring to ascend to higher levels of German football, such as the Regionalliga.

The tournament features a diverse array of clubs, ranging from historic teams with rich traditions to emerging sides eager to make their mark. Matches are characterized by passionate rivalries, enthusiastic local support, and a vibrant atmosphere that reflects the deep-rooted love for the sport in the region.

Typically held annually, the Oberliga Schleswig-Holstein operates on a league format, where teams compete in a series of matches throughout the season. Points are awarded for wins and draws, with the ultimate goal of finishing at the top of the standings. The top-performing teams may earn promotion to the higher divisions, while others face the challenge of avoiding relegation.
